Weak Directory Permission Vulnerability in Microsoft Windows client in McAfee True Key (TK) 5.1.230.7 and earlier allows local users to execute arbitrary code via specially crafted malware.

CVE-2018-6755 has a critical severity rating, allowing local users to execute arbitrary code.
To fix CVE-2018-6755, update McAfee True Key to version 5.1.230.8 or later.
CVE-2018-6755 affects local users of McAfee True Key versions 5.1.230.7 and earlier.
Attackers can leverage CVE-2018-6755 to execute arbitrary code on affected systems.
Microsoft Windows itself is not directly affected by CVE-2018-6755, but it allows the exploitation of McAfee True Key.
